What are the Ural Mountains?
The Ural Mountains are a major mountain range in western Russia that runs roughly north to south for about 2,500 kilometers, from the Arctic Ocean down toward the Ural River and Kazakhstan. In World Geography, you usually see them as a physical feature that separates the European and Asian parts of Russia and helps define the continent boundary students memorize on maps.
They are not the kind of giant, jagged mountains you would picture in a young, active range like the Himalayas. The Urals are very old, formed more than 250 million years ago during the Uralian orogeny. Because they have been worn down for so long, many parts are lower and rounder than newer mountain chains, even though the range is still geographically significant.
The Urals matter because they sit in a zone where landforms connect to human life. They contain mineral resources such as coal, iron ore, and precious metals, which has made the region useful for industry and transport. That is a classic World Geography idea: physical geography does not just sit on a map, it affects where people mine, build, travel, and settle.
They also influence climate. Mountains can block air masses and change how moisture moves across a region, so one side of a range may be wetter or colder than the other. In Russia, the Urals help shape patterns between European Russia and the lands farther east, which is why they show up in lessons on climate, relief, and regional differences.
The range also supports different ecosystems from north to south. Tundra appears in the far north, while taiga forests and steppe landscapes are more common farther south. That shift is a good reminder that latitude, elevation, and climate all work together, so a single mountain chain can cross several environmental zones.
Why the Ural Mountains matter in World Geography
The Ural Mountains are one of the cleanest examples of how a physical landmark can organize an entire region. In World Geography, you use them to explain why Russia is often described in two broad parts, how natural barriers affect movement, and why resource distribution is never random.
They also connect several course ideas at once. You can link them to tectonic history, because they were formed by mountain-building processes long ago. You can link them to climate because mountains influence wind and precipitation patterns. You can link them to economic geography because mineral-rich areas often become centers of extraction and industrial activity.
This makes the Urals useful in map work and regional analysis. If you are comparing Europe and Asia, or explaining how physical geography affects settlement and transportation, the Urals give you a concrete example instead of a vague generalization. They are a boundary, a resource zone, and an environmental divider all in one.

The Ural Mountains vs Altai Mountains
Both are major mountain ranges in Eurasia, but the Ural Mountains are the classic Europe-Asia boundary in Russia, while the Altai Mountains are farther south and east in Central Asia. The Urals are also much older and more eroded, so they tend to be lower and less dramatic than younger ranges students often compare them with.

How are the Ural Mountains different from younger mountain ranges?
The Urals are much older than ranges like the Himalayas, so they have been worn down more by erosion. That means they are generally lower and less rugged. This difference is a useful reminder that mountain age changes the look of the landscape.
